Dorothy May Ford

Dorothy May Ford, 81, passed away Sunday, Feb. 6, 2022 at Columbus Regional Hospital. Dorothy was born on May 8, 1941 in Joliet, Illinois. She was the daughter of Herman Paul and Mildred Alberta Raber.
She graduated from Center Grove High School in 1959 and then attended the Indianapolis School of Practical Nursing. After nursing school, Dorothy began working as a Qualified Medication Aide. She worked as a QMA for over 30 years before she retired.
Dorothy married Norman D. Ford Sr. on Oct. 7, 1960 and he survives. Dorothy and Norman were long-time members of Shiloh Baptist Church. She was a firm believer in God and was an excellent example of faith to her children and grandchildren. Dorothy was also a member of the Women’s Auxiliary of the American Legion Post #24.
Dorothy enjoyed reading, bowling, playing Bingo, and crafting, especially crocheting. She placed her family above everything else and family was the light of her life. She was a devoted wife, loving mother, and a doting grandmother and great-grandmother.
Dorothy leaves behind her husband of 61 years, Norman D. Ford Sr.; her children, Norman D. (Jean) Ford Jr., Kevin (Stacy) Ford, Belinda Ford, and Tracy (Ray) Bundy; her brother, Robert (Nancy) Raber, sister, Greta Nowling; 11 grandchildren, and 21 great-grandchildren.
She was preceded in death by her parents; her son, Shannon D. Ford; and great-grandson, Cameron Zeigler.
